Technical Trend Overview and Price Movement
The stock closed at ₹7,280.00 on 28 Jul 2026, slightly up from the previous close of ₹7,260.75. Intraday volatility was evident with a high of ₹7,369.20 and a low of ₹7,249.05. Over the past 52 weeks, Amber Enterprises has traded between ₹5,404.00 and ₹8,970.00, indicating a wide price range and significant volatility. The recent technical trend has shifted from mildly bearish to sideways, signalling a potential pause in the downward momentum that had characterised the stock’s performance in recent weeks.
MACD and Momentum Indicators
The Moving Average Convergence Divergence (MACD) remains mildly bearish on both weekly and monthly timeframes, suggesting that the underlying momentum is still under pressure despite the sideways price action. The MACD histogram has shown reduced negative divergence, indicating that bearish momentum is waning but not yet reversed. This cautious stance is reinforced by the KST (Know Sure Thing) indicator, which also remains mildly bearish across weekly and monthly charts, signalling that momentum has not fully recovered.
RSI and Overbought/Oversold Conditions
The Relative Strength Index (RSI) on both weekly and monthly charts currently shows no clear signal, hovering around neutral levels. This lack of directional RSI momentum suggests that the stock is neither overbought nor oversold, consistent with the sideways trend. The absence of extreme RSI readings implies that Amber Enterprises is consolidating, awaiting a catalyst to drive a decisive move either upwards or downwards.
Moving Averages and Bollinger Bands
Daily moving averages have turned mildly bullish, with the short-term averages crossing above longer-term averages, signalling a tentative positive shift in price momentum. However, the Bollinger Bands present a mixed picture: weekly bands remain mildly bearish, indicating some downward pressure, while monthly bands have flattened, reflecting sideways price action. This divergence between short-term bullishness and longer-term caution highlights the stock’s current indecision phase.

Volume and On-Balance Volume (OBV) Analysis
On-Balance Volume (OBV) indicators show no clear trend on the weekly chart but remain mildly bearish on the monthly chart. This suggests that volume flows have not decisively supported a bullish reversal, with selling pressure still present over the longer term. The lack of strong volume confirmation tempers optimism from the daily moving averages and indicates that any upward price moves may lack conviction.
Dow Theory and Broader Market Context
According to Dow Theory, both weekly and monthly charts show no definitive trend, reinforcing the sideways technical stance. This indecision is mirrored in the stock’s relative performance against the Sensex. While Amber Enterprises has underperformed the benchmark over short-term periods—declining 7.27% over one week and 4.96% over one month compared to Sensex losses of 1.12% and 0.34% respectively—it has outperformed significantly over longer horizons. Year-to-date, the stock has gained 14.08% versus a Sensex decline of 9.84%, and over three years, it has surged 197.12% compared to the Sensex’s 15.95% gain.
Long-Term Returns and Market Capitalisation
Amber Enterprises’ small-cap status is reflected in its market cap grading, which remains modest relative to larger sector peers. Despite this, the company has delivered impressive long-term returns, with a 5-year gain of 141.06% compared to the Sensex’s 46.13%. This strong historical performance contrasts with the current technical caution, suggesting that investors should weigh the stock’s growth potential against near-term volatility and mixed technical signals.

Investor Takeaway and Outlook
Amber Enterprises India Ltd currently presents a complex technical picture. The shift from mildly bearish to sideways trend suggests a consolidation phase, with daily moving averages hinting at a nascent bullish momentum. However, the persistence of mildly bearish MACD and KST readings, combined with neutral RSI and weak volume confirmation, advises caution. The stock’s recent underperformance relative to the Sensex in the short term contrasts with its strong long-term returns, underscoring the importance of a balanced investment approach.
Investors should monitor key technical levels closely. A sustained move above the recent intraday high of ₹7,369.20, supported by volume, could signal a more robust recovery. Conversely, a breakdown below the recent low of ₹7,249.05 may reignite bearish momentum. Given the current Strong Sell Mojo Grade, risk-averse investors might consider alternative opportunities within the sector or broader market until clearer technical confirmation emerges.
In summary, Amber Enterprises is at a technical crossroads. While early signs of stabilisation are evident, the mixed signals from momentum and volume indicators counsel a wait-and-watch stance. The stock’s impressive long-term performance remains a positive backdrop, but near-term volatility and technical uncertainty require careful analysis before committing fresh capital.
